Anyway..for the sake of the doggies welfare, either place would be good as long as they can provide shelter, food and care. BUT there is one thing that I would like to point out. If by temporary means a couple of days/weeks...my suggestions is to go with a place that can provide them more stable enviroment or at least a longer period of time to stay, instead of having to re-home them twice.

We have to be realize also that it's not easy to find a home for these doggies...find a more permanent place for them rather then moving them a few times. Each time we move them, they would be under some stress..

In anycase, we all want what is best for the doggies...

I did be worried if the team just bring the doggies to some "parents" and later the "parents" find that the doggies is not suitable for the household and in the end, have to "return" the doggie.

We have relealize that having a pet is not like going to Toys'r Us to buy a doll.

The potential pet owner must be able to know the temprement, the characteristic of the dog before committing it to the family. It's a big responsibility. We do not want to place a dog in a home that might not be suitable for the family as well. It will be detrimental to both party.

Alot of dog abuse cases is due to the fact that the owner is not able to handle the pet and have to resort to some sort of corporal punishment, which easily leads to the abuse of the animals.
